Introduction
Infantry, since time immemorial, are the core of any army. A man with a weapon can do things that no jet, drone, or tank can do, and can be equipped to take one of the above on and even defeat it. In modern 4th generation warfare, the infantryman is even more important than in previous wars, where your enemy will oftentimes be hiding in plain sight and fighting in streets and close terrain, where most other weapon systems are of limited to no effectiveness. Examples of this can be seen all around; Israeli experiences with Syrian and Egyptian tank-hunters in 1973 and 1982, Coalition experiences in Iraq, Soviet invasion of Afghanistan, Vietnam, etc.
And, just like any modern army, and particularly in light of recent wars, infantry pay a crucial role in the Riysian Joint Ground Forces. Here, we will cover the two main divisions of infantry - Mobile Infantry, and Armoured Infantry.
Definitions
As previously mentioned, most infantry in the Riysian Joint Ground Forces are divided into two categories, both of which fall under the term "mechanized infantry":
Mobile Infantry, which refers to lighter infantry mounted in APCs, such as Riysa's trademark NJM Salamah.
Armoured Infantry, which refers to heavier infantry mounted in IFVs, such as the powerful NJM Salah ad-Din.
Note though that the main difference between the two classifications line primarily in doctrine & tactical usage, while the infantry squad itself is virtually the same for both mobile and armoured infantry, baring the transport used. This will be covered shortly.
Equipment
The standard-issue rifle of the Riysian Joint Ground Forces is the B.854 battle rifle. It fires a 8.54 x 60 mm round, with a rate of fire of up to 700 rounds per minute, and an effective range of up to 800 meters with ironsights adjusted to the long-range setting. This rifle, with the correct ammunition, is capable of piercing even the heaviest of modern body armor. The rifle uses a balanced recoil mechanism similar to that used on the AK-107, allowing for reduced recoil and better control than many battle rifles. With rails, it can be heavily accessorized, with optics, laser sights, vertical grips, and grenade launchers.
The B.854RA is a squad automatic weapon based on the B.854, sharing many of the same characteristics and parts and firing the same ammunition. One of the main differences is the use of a heavier barrel to allow it to fire for long periods of time, and a reworked receiver that allows it to fire at up to 800 rounds per minute.
For anti-tank firepower, the weapon of choice for Riysian infantry squads is the SMD-18 "Zilzal". It is a 18 kilogram (loaded) anti-tank missile system, with the missile guided by "SACLOS" laser-beam riding. It can attack targets as far as a kilometer away and as close as 17 meters, and can penetrate up to a meter of solid steel, making it a potent infantry weapon.
NOTE: If you are a squad anti-tank specialist, work with your squad to find cover and ensure a clear shot before engaging enemy vehicles. Firing the SMD-18 will leave you most likely unable to relocate until after the missile has impacted or has been defeated, due to its guidance method.
